About the art: I'm continuing my exploration of incorporating the wood panel color and texture into paintings. It feels very exciting to me ! For this one I began with a sketch and created a stencil to mask off the figure shape. I taped the top and bottom and then put on a smooth coat of black gesso, preserving the wood for Santa's figure. Then some painstaking pen and ink for all of the line work, and a tiny Posca Pen in white for the highlights. Though a figure of this size and detail might seem tedious, it is actually quite meditative. It requires full presence to be in control of every line - no mind wandering when using pen and ink on wood!
